Adin vs Adisyn

American parents have registered 3,355 Adins since 1880, against 1,138 Adisyns. Adin is still ahead, with 46 babies in 2025.

Who was ahead

Adin has been the commoner name in every year either was published, 1914 to 2025. The lead has never changed hands.

The closest they came was 2012, when Adin had 103 and Adisyn had 84.
